About St Francis Xavier Primary School WOOLGOOLGA

St Francis Xavier School is co-educational Catholic Primary School catering for students from Early Stage 1 to Years 6. 

The school is located 500 metres from the Pacific Ocean in Woolgoolga, New South Wales and enjoys a close relationships with the Coffs Harbour Parish community. The school is the second of two Primary Schools established within the Parish of St Augustine's.

Curriculum

St Francis Xavier school curriculum follows seven Key Learning Areas including Religious Education, Mathematics, Science and Technology, Creative Arts, History and Geography, English and Personal Development, Healthy and Physical Education. Technology has been integrated into every area of the curriculum. Each day students engage in literacy in numeracy blocks of studying. Extra-curricular activities include band instrumental lessons, violin and piano lessons as well as lunchtime interest clubs. Daily prayer is important and liturgies are celebrated regularly. Leadership by students is an important part of school life and Year 6 students are provided with additional leadership roles.
